At the University of Zagreb, Faculty of Organization and Informatics, a kick-off conference for the three-year research and innovation project HeyAIde – Health Empowerment for You through AI Direct Engagement was held on April 29, 2026. The project is led by BIT4BYTES Ltd., in collaboration with partners FOI, Revent Smart Ltd., and ValMod Center, with the goal of researching and developing innovative smart solutions for personalized remote patient monitoring, consultations, and therapies.

The 2026 Science Festival was held from April 20 to 25 across Croatia, and this year’s theme was energy – a fundamental driver of nature, society, and technological development. The University of Zagreb, Faculty of Organization and Informatics, once again actively participated in the festival program through a series of engaging and interactive activities for all age groups – from the youngest participants to the general public.
